Watch 'Lost,' 'House' and 'Fringe' Showrunners in New Documentary Trailer (Video)
Fan of Lost, House or Spartacus? A new documentary, Showrunners, details the people running the TV shows behind the scenes.
Several players, including participants in this year's THR drama showrunner Emmy roundtable Sons of Anarchy's Kurt Sutter and Men of a Certain Age's Mike Royce, are featured in a doc that delves into the blurred lines between being a writer, producer and the face of a TV show.

Also included are House's David Shore (interviewed before Fox officially picked up the series for Season 8), TNT exec Michael Wright, Spartacus' Steven S. DeKnight, former Without a Trace star Anthony LaPaglia, Battlestar Galactica's David Eick, Fringe EPs Jeff Pinkner and J.H. Wyman, Dirt's Matthew Carnahan, Ben Silverman and One Tree Hill's Mark Schwahn.
The Good Wife's Michelle King, Janet Tamaro of TNT's Rizzoli & Isles and House writer Pam Davis also will appear, though aren't in the trailer, according to the film's Facebook page.
